Ubuntu新手入门

Ubuntu Desktop 系统特点如下

  • 桌面环境采用 LXDE/GNOME

  • 针对嵌入式平台,精简系统服务

  • 提供基于 Arm Mali GPU 的 OpenGL、OpenCL 支持

  • 提供基于 Rockchip VPU + Mpp 的视频硬编解码支持

  • 适配 QT、Docker、Electron 等开发框架

  • 提供一系列接口,以操作板载资源设备

  • 系统采用 overlayfs 文件系统,支持导出 rootfs,二次打包,恢复出厂设置等功能

../../_images/ubuntu_desktop.png

用户和密码

Ubuntu Desktop 系统开机启动后,自动登录到 neardi 用户

  • neardi 用户密码:lindikeji 或 neardi

  • root 用户:默认没有设置 root 密码,neardi 用户通过 sudo passwd root 命令自行配置 root 密码

注:有的固件版本比较老,用户名账号密码都是linaro

打开终端查看当前用户

whoami

ADB使用

有线ADB

通过Type-C/双头USB连接设备和PC 端

adb devices
adb shell

网络ADB

查看开发板 IP 地址

ifconfig

PC 端通过网络访问

adb connect 192.168.x.x
adb shell

SSH使用

SSH连接

查看开发板 IP 地址

ifconfig

PC 端通过网络访问

ssh neardi@192.168.x.x

SSH拷贝

从PC 端拷贝 test.txt 到设备/home/neardi目录

scp /Users/work/neardi/test.txt neardi@192.168.x.x:/home/neardi/

从设备/home/neardi目录拷贝 test.txt 到PC 端

scp neardi@192.168.x.x:/home/neardi/test.txt /Users/work/neardi/